Effect of urapidil on beta-adrenoceptors of rat atria.

A J Verberne, M J Rand.   

Abstract

The effects of the antihypertensive drug urapidil were studied on chronotropic responses to isoprenaline in rat isolated atria. Urapidil (1-30 microM) antagonized the responses to isoprenaline competitively, and the pA2 value was 6.05. Thus, in addition to its alpha 1-adrenoceptor blocking action for which the pA2 value is about 7, urapidil has beta-adrenoceptor blocking activity.
